DRIVER

"Increasing demand for high-performance lubricants and catalysts"

The rise in usage of Molybdenum Disulfide (MoS₂) as a solid lubricant in automotive engine components, industrial greases, and aerospace bearings is a primary driver. Powder forms comprising about 90.2% of form share are heavily used in lubricants & greases (54.6% of applications), where wear reduction, friction reduction, and durability are essential. Catalyst applications, also significant (20-30% in many reports), increasingly require MoS₂ of high purity and specific particle size. Asia-Pacific demand in industrial machinery, chemical processing, electronics also drive consumption. Governments mandating lower emissions push lubricant efficiency; in USA and Europe increased regulatory pressure on emissions and fuel economy stimulates higher quality lubricant additive uptake.

RESTRAINT

"High cost and purity requirements with supply constraints"

High-purity crystal forms of MoS₂, though only 9.8% of form share, cost substantially more; achieving purity above 99.9% is complex, increasing production cost. Raw molybdenum feedstock supply often volatile: reports denote 10-15% annual variation in molybdenum oxide market, which directly impacts MoS₂ input cost. Suppliers of powder forms may face difficulty meeting stringent specifications for electronics or catalyst use, where particle size, crystallinity, impurity levels must be tightly controlled non-compliance for approx 20-30% of batches in some precision industries. Also, competition from alternative solid lubricants constrains pricing power; in lubricant sector, substitutes take up 10-20% potential market.

OPPORTUNITY

"Application expansion in electronics, semiconductors, renewable energy"

Electronic and semiconductor uses of MoS₂ are growing; reports indicate Asia-Pacific electronics demand is strong, with China, Japan, South Korea increasing consumption by measurable volume. Use in 2D semiconductors, sensors, flexible electronics is enabling new market segments. Catalyst use in hydrodesulfurization, clean energy, hydrogen evolution reaction includes MoS₂; these specialty applications often require crystal or high-purity powder grades. Industrial machinery demand in mining, construction, heavy equipment offers opportunity greases and coatings enhancements. Energy storage and battery technologies, while smaller currently, show early uptake. Each opportunity taps markets beyond traditional lubricant uses, expanding MoS₂ Market Growth and Market Opportunities in B2B sectors.

CHALLENGE

"Environmental regulations, alternative materials, and technical limitations"

Environmental regulations increasing around emissions, particulate matter, and lubricant disposal pressure MoS₂ producers and formulators to ensure non-toxicity and lifecycle safety; failure to do so may block certain applications, especially in EU and North America. Alternative materials and lubricants (e.g. graphite, tungsten disulfide) compete; for some 10-20% of lubricant applications, these alternatives are considered viable. Technical challenges: producing crystals with consistent quality, particle size distribution; retaining performance under extreme pressure, temperature; some electronics uses require defect-free materials, which >30% of current production may not satisfy. Scaling production for high-purity forms without increasing defect rates or impurity levels is difficult.

Lubricant: Lubricants & greases represent about 54.6% of global MoS₂ usage as of 2024, primarily in automotive, industrial machinery, aerospace and heavy equipment sectors. MoS₂ powder is used in lubricant base oils or greases to reduce wear, lower friction, enhance load capacity.

Catalysts: Catalyst application of MoS₂ is significant, making up approximately 20-30% of non-lubricant applications of MoS₂. MoS₂ is used in hydrodesulfurization in refineries, chemical processing, and increasingly in hydrogen evolution reaction (HER) catalysts.

Others: “Others” includes electronics & semiconductors, coatings, sensors, optical devices and specialty industrial uses, comprising approximately 15-25% of total application share. In electronics, MoS₂ crystals or high-purity powder are used in transistors, photodetectors, flexible devices.

New Product Development

New product development in the Molybdenum Disulfide Market focuses on enhanced powder grades, high purity crystals, nanostructured forms, dispersion technologies, and multifunctional coatings. Powder variants are being engineered with controlled particle sizes (1-5 µm and ultrafine <1 µm) to improve dispersion in lubricants and greases; about 30-40% of new lubricant additive products include MoS₂ of finer particles.
